Where Wake County, NC Auto, Life & Health Insurance Brokers Serve

Wake County, NC is a bustling area with a diverse range of landmarks, top employers, major highways and streets, and neighborhoods. From the historic State Capitol building to the modern PNC Arena, there is something for everyone in this vibrant county. The top employers in Wake County include tech giants like IBM and Cisco, as well as healthcare institutions like WakeMed and UNC Rex Healthcare. These companies provide ample job opportunities for residents and contribute to the county's thriving economy. Major highways like I-40, I-440, and US-1 provide easy access to neighboring cities like Durham and Chapel Hill, while local streets like Hillsborough Street and Capital Boulevard connect residents to popular shopping and dining destinations. Wake County is home to a variety of neighborhoods, each with its unique character and charm. From the trendy downtown Raleigh area to the family-friendly suburbs of Cary and Apex, there is a neighborhood to suit every lifestyle.
